以文本方式查看主题 - Foxtable(狐表) (http://foxtable.com/bbs/index.asp) -- 专家坐堂 (http://foxtable.com/bbs/list.asp?boardid=2) ---- 加载外部数据的问题 (http://foxtable.com/bbs/dispbbs.asp?boardid=2&id=78283) |
-- 作者:zhangchi96 -- 发布时间:2015/12/6 11:26:00 -- 加载外部数据的问题 在窗体中设置了四个按钮 1:清空加载的数据(不加载数据) Dim Filter As String Filter = "[_identify] is null " DataTables("网络职岗工资标准").LoadFilter = Filter \'设置加载条件 DataTables("网络职岗工资标准").Load() 2:加载1 行数据 Dim Filter As String Filter = "" DataTables("网络职岗工资标准").LoadFilter = Filter DataTables("网络职岗工资标准").Load() DataTables("网络职岗工资标准").LoadTop = "1" 3:加载10 行数据 Dim Filter As String Filter = "" DataTables("网络职岗工资标准").LoadFilter = Filter DataTables("网络职岗工资标准").Load() DataTables("网络职岗工资标准").LoadTop = "10" 4:加载全部 Dim Filter2 As String Filter2 = "" DataTables("网络职岗工资标准").LoadFilter = Filter2 DataTables("网络职岗工资标准").Load() 点击第1、2个按钮,结果正常,再点第3个按钮,点击一下时加载1行,再点击一下就才会加载10行,点击第4个按钮,根据没有反应,请问这是什么原因造成的,在其他地方也有加载的代码,但似乎没有遇到这个问题。 [此贴子已经被作者于2015/12/6 11:27:04编辑过]
|
-- 作者:zhangchi96 -- 发布时间:2015/12/6 13:16:00 -- 第3个按钮按下列写法就运行正常 Dim Filter As String Filter = "" DataTables("网络职岗工资标准").LoadFilter = Filter DataTables("网络职岗工资标准").Load() DataTables("网络职岗工资标准").LoadTop = "10" DataTables("网络职岗工资标准").Load() DataTables("网络职岗工资标准").LoadTop = "10" |
-- 作者:大红袍 -- 发布时间:2015/12/6 14:26:00 -- Dim Filter As String Filter = ""
DataTables("网络职岗工资标准").LoadTop = "10" DataTables("网络职岗工资标准").LoadFilter = Filter
DataTables("网络职岗工资标准").Load()
|
-- 作者:大红袍 -- 发布时间:2015/12/6 14:26:00 -- Dim Filter As String Filter = ""
DataTables("网络职岗工资标准").LoadTop = "100 percent" DataTables("网络职岗工资标准").LoadFilter = Filter
DataTables("网络职岗工资标准").Load()
|
-- 作者:zhangchi96 -- 发布时间:2015/12/6 16:53:00 -- 是应该把加载的行数写在前面啊,我执行两次的时候 第二次是用 了我认为的第一次的行数要求了,不知道我理解的对不对? |
-- 作者:大红袍 -- 发布时间:2015/12/6 17:27:00 -- 写在前面,再load |
-- 作者:zhangchi96 -- 发布时间:2015/12/6 17:35:00 -- 我看疏忽了,谢谢大红袍老师! |